FIFA's Intervention Explained

The recent decision by FIFA to allow Folarin Balogun to participate in the high-stakes knockout match against Belgium is a crucial development for the USA soccer team. Balogun, who has been a key player throughout the tournament, faced a ban that raised concerns among fans and analysts alike. FIFA's intervention underscores the organization's intent to ensure that all teams have access to their best players during critical moments.
